Just a small correction to your "Hannah's line". Hannah was indeed the
mother of George Catley and the daughter of Charles Catley and Mary Petty.
She was an assisted migrant to South Australia, arriving on the "Ganges",
23 Jun 1839. At the time she applied for an assisted passage, she was a
domestic servant aged 26 yrs, living at 5 Comberwell Green, London. (Note: I
think this should be Camberwell Green). She married Joseph Watson in
Adelaide, S.A. 14 Nov 1840. They had 12 children. She died in Petersham,
an inner Sydney suburb on 31 Jul 1903.
Her son, George Catley married Mary Ann Harrison in West Hackney, Middlesex
15 Feb 1851. They migrated to Australia with their two children, George
Herbert and Ernest Thomas, arriving Sydney 21 Feb 1855 on the "Abdalla"
which departed Plymouth 3 Nov 1854, chartered by the Family Colonization
Loan Society.

Fortunately your request for information on Ronald William Catley falls
into
the easier category. He was born in NSW in 1916, the son of Ernest
Thomas
Catley and Mary Christina Cullen. I am aware of a sibling, Roy Catley
died
1923. This Ernest Thomas Catley was born Sydney 1881, the son of another
Ernest Thomas Catley whose birth was registered in Edmonton, Middlesex in
Dec Qtr 1853, the son of George Catley and Mary Ann Harrison who migrated
to Sydney in 1855. They belong to the James of Barley tree.
